Situated:

The Abbey Mill Valley centre is situated in Tintern Village and is the original mill site of the Tintern Abbey which was founded in 1131. To See And Do:

Shopping – there are 5 different craft shops housed in the old mill. Food and drink - there is a coffee shop and restaurant.

Aberdulais

Situated:

Aberdulais is a small village situated in Neath Port Talbot. It is known for its Tin Plate industry in the early 1800s. To See And Do:

Aberdulais waterfalls The water wheel powdered by the waterfalls The canal The Tramway Bridge Cefn Coed Colliery Museum – this is a former coal mine The Old Stables – houses an interactive story of the tinplate mines and the lives of the people Waterfall Cottage – the only remaining tinplate workers cottage Chimney Stack - was used in the tinplate manufacturing process Turbine House – this turbine now produces green electricity The Tinning House – part of the Tin Plate buildings

Abergele

Situated:

Abergele is situated on the between Colwyn Bay and Rhyl. It is an old Roman trading town. To See And Do:

Pensarn beach – nice quiet beach to relax on Bodelwyddan Castle – it was built in 1460 and is a Grade II listed building 2 Iron Age hill forts at Castell Cawr Gwyych Castle ruin – a 19th century folly built on the site of a 12th century Norman Castle Wooded hillside with many caves Tower Hill and the 400 year old watchtower Traditional lynch gate entrance Penitential stone Many paths for walking and hiking Fishing Horse riding Mountain biking
